Preheat the oven to 400°F / 200°C. Line a baking dish with parchment paper or lightly grease it.
Mix 3 tablespoons tomato paste, ½ teaspoon kosher salt, 1 tablespoon lemon juice, and 1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il in a large bowl.
Pat 750 g boneless skinless chicken thighs dry with paper towels. Add them to the tomato paste marinade and coat each piece evenly.
Arrange the chicken thighs in a single layer in the prepared baking dish. Spread any remaining marinade over the top.
Bake for 20–25 minutes. Check the thickest part with an instant-read thermometer. Remove the chicken when it reaches 165°F (74°C).
Rest the chicken for 5 minutes before serving.
Notes
Optional marinating: For deeper flavor, coat the chicken and refrigerate it for 10–15 minutes before baking. This optional time is not included in the total time.Check the size: Chicken thighs vary in thickness, so begin checking their temperature after 20 minutes to prevent overcooking.Leave space between the pieces: Arrange the thighs in one layer without crowding so they roast instead of steaming.
